    Key Finance Roles to Consider

    Let's break down some of the most sought-after finance careers in PSEPSEIIWORLDsese. First up, we have the Financial Analyst. These guys are the detectives of the finance world, digging into data to understand financial performance, forecast future trends, and provide recommendations. They work across various industries, from tech startups to established corporations, helping businesses make smarter financial decisions. Their role is crucial for budgeting, forecasting, and strategic planning. Next, consider Investment Banking. This is a high-octane field where you'll be involved in advising companies on raising capital through issuing stocks or bonds, or facilitating mergers and acquisitions (M&A). It's demanding, often requiring long hours, but the exposure and potential rewards are significant. Then there's Portfolio Management. If you have a knack for investing and understanding market movements, this role is for you. Portfolio managers are responsible for making investment decisions on behalf of clients, aiming to maximize returns while managing risk. This requires a deep understanding of various asset classes, economic indicators, and market sentiment. Another vital area is Risk Management. In today's volatile economic climate, companies desperately need professionals who can identify, assess, and mitigate financial risks. This could involve market risk, credit risk, operational risk, or liquidity risk. These professionals ensure the stability and solvency of the organization. Finally, Corporate Finance roles within companies focus on managing a company's financial health. This includes financial planning and analysis (FP&A), treasury operations, and capital structure management. These roles are essential for the day-to-day financial operations and long-term strategic financial health of any business. Each of these roles offers a unique path with distinct challenges and opportunities for growth within PSEPSEIIWORLDsese's financial ecosystem.

    Risk Management: Navigating Uncertainty

    In the intricate world of finance, risk management is a career that's becoming increasingly critical, especially within the dynamic economy of PSEPSEIIWORLDsese. Essentially, risk managers are the guardians of financial stability. They identify, assess, and develop strategies to mitigate potential risks that could harm an organization's financial health. These risks can span a wide spectrum: market risk (fluctuations in stock prices, interest rates), credit risk (the chance a borrower will default), operational risk (failures in internal processes or systems), and liquidity risk (not having enough cash to meet obligations). For guys who enjoy problem-solving and have a meticulous eye for detail, this field offers a deeply rewarding path. The financial services industry in PSEPSEIIWORLDsese, like anywhere else, is subject to global economic shifts, regulatory changes, and unforeseen events. Therefore, the role of a risk manager is paramount in ensuring resilience and protecting assets. This career demands a strong understanding of financial markets, statistical analysis, and regulatory compliance. It often involves working closely with various departments, including trading, operations, and legal, to implement robust risk management frameworks. The ability to think critically, anticipate potential problems, and develop proactive solutions is highly valued. As financial instruments become more complex and global interconnectedness increases, the demand for skilled risk management professionals in PSEPSEIIWORLDsese is on a steady rise. It's a challenging but essential function that contributes significantly to the stability and integrity of the financial system, making it a stable and impactful career choice.

    Education and Qualifications

    Getting into finance careers in PSEPSEIIWORLDsese often starts with a solid educational foundation. Most roles require at least a bachelor's degree in finance, economics, accounting, mathematics, or a related quantitative field. A strong academic record is definitely a plus! For more specialized or senior roles, pursuing a master's degree in finance or an MBA with a finance concentration can provide a significant advantage. Beyond degrees, professional certifications are highly valued and can significantly boost your credibility and career prospects. Some of the most recognized certifications include the Chartered Financial Analyst (CFA) designation, which is globally respected and demonstrates expertise in investment analysis and portfolio management. For those interested in accounting and auditing within the finance sector, the Certified Public Accountant (CPA) or similar local accounting certifications are essential. Other relevant certifications might include the Financial Risk Manager (FRM) for those focusing on risk management. Networking with professionals in the field and seeking internships during your studies are also crucial steps. These practical experiences provide invaluable insights into the industry and can lead to full-time job offers. PSEPSEIIWORLDsese's financial institutions often look for candidates who not only possess theoretical knowledge but also demonstrate practical application through internships and projects. Staying updated with industry trends and continuously enhancing your knowledge through workshops and courses is also part of the journey to a successful finance career here.

    The Power of Certifications

    Guys, let's talk about leveling up your finance careers in PSEPSEIIWORLDsese with certifications. While a degree gets your foot in the door, professional certifications are like a superpower that makes you stand out from the crowd. The Chartered Financial Analyst (CFA) program is the gold standard for investment professionals. It's rigorous, covering everything from ethical standards to investment tools and portfolio management. Earning the CFA charter signals to employers that you have a deep understanding of investment principles and a commitment to the profession. It's globally recognized, so it's valuable wherever you are, including right here in PSEPSEIIWORLDsese. For those leaning towards risk management, the Financial Risk Manager (FRM) certification is a fantastic choice. It focuses specifically on identifying, measuring, and managing financial risk, a critical function in today's market. If your interests lie more in accounting and financial reporting within a corporate setting, then certifications like the Certified Public Accountant (CPA) are essential. These credentials demonstrate a mastery of accounting standards and practices. Getting certified often requires a combination of work experience and passing challenging exams, but the payoff is immense. It not only enhances your knowledge base but also significantly improves your employability and earning potential. In PSEPSEIIWORLDsese, where the financial sector is growing, employers actively seek candidates with these recognized qualifications. They provide a standardized measure of expertise and a commitment to professional development that is highly respected. Investing in these certifications is investing in your future, ensuring you have the tools and credentials to thrive in competitive finance careers.
